My Buying Guides on Belt Drive Ceiling Fan

Why I Consider a Belt Drive Ceiling Fan

When I look for a ceiling fan, I want something that feels dependable, quiet, and efficient. A belt drive ceiling fan stands out to me because it uses a belt mechanism to transfer power, which can help reduce noise and provide smoother operation. If I am choosing a fan for a space where comfort matters, I pay close attention to this type of design.

What I Look for in Performance

For me, the first thing is airflow. I want a fan that moves air well without sounding loud or shaky. I also check whether the fan can run at different speeds, because I like having control depending on the season. In my experience, a good belt drive ceiling fan should feel steady and deliver consistent circulation.

Why I Care About Noise Level

Noise is a big factor for me, especially if I plan to use the fan in a bedroom, office, or living room. I prefer a model that runs quietly so it does not interrupt sleep, work, or conversation. Since belt drive systems are often associated with smoother operation, I always consider this a major advantage.

Build Quality Matters to Me

I always inspect the materials before buying. A strong motor, durable belt, and well-made blades give me more confidence that the fan will last. I also like finishes that resist wear and match my room’s style. To me, solid construction is just as important as appearance.

Energy Efficiency Is Important

I try to choose a fan that helps me save on electricity while still keeping the room comfortable. If a belt drive ceiling fan uses less power but still provides good airflow, that is a win for me. I also pay attention to whether the fan is designed for long-term use without wasting energy.

Size and Room Fit

I always match the fan size to the room. A fan that is too small will not cool properly, and one that is too large can feel overwhelming in a compact space. I think about ceiling height, room size, and blade span before making my choice. For me, the right fit makes a huge difference in comfort.

Installation and Maintenance

I prefer a fan that is not overly complicated to install. If I can set it up easily or have it installed without hassle, that saves time and effort. I also look for a design that is easy to maintain, because I want cleaning and belt checks to be simple. In my experience, low-maintenance products are always more practical.

Style and Design

I do not want my ceiling fan to look out of place. I usually choose a style that blends with my interior, whether modern, classic, or industrial. Blade shape, color, and finish all matter to me because the fan becomes part of the room’s overall look.
